Racó Alt
Racó Alt is an anchorage off the dramatic limestone cliffs of Formentera's eastern coast, where you drop the hook in clear turquoise water and swim straight to the rock face. It's raw and exposed in a beautiful way — no crowds, no infrastructure, just the cliffs, the sea, and the trail up to Punta des Bou nearby if you fancy stretching your legs on land.
